How many CVEs affect Qualcomm?
Qualcomm has 46,786 CVE records in our database, including 9787 critical and 28782 high severity vulnerabilities. 12 of these are listed in CISA's Known Exploited Vulnerabilities catalog.
What are the most severe Qualcomm vulnerabilities?
Qualcomm has 9787 critical severity (CVSS 9.0+) and 28782 high severity (CVSS 7.0-8.9) vulnerabilities. 12 vulnerabilities are confirmed as actively exploited in the wild.
